#13b91d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13b91d is composed of 7.5% red, 72.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 123.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 40%. #13b91d color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ff3a with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#13b91d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13b91d has RGB values of R:19, G:185,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1292573.

Shades and Tints of #13b91d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010701 is the darkest color, while #f4f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#13b91d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616b62 is the less saturated color, while #03c90f is the most saturated one.
